From Lady Jane Grey to George Eliot, this place holds so many stories. If you examine the gravestones in the churchyard you’ll find names that Eliot used for her characters. Inside the church is full of wall paintings and interesting nooks and crannies to explore. The Misericords in the chancel hold some surprises! Can you find the pig and the lady?
